Code C0047 Description
The C0047 code indicates a problem with the brake booster pressure sensor in the vehicle. The brake booster pressure sensor is responsible for monitoring the pressure within the brake booster system, which assists in applying the brakes. When this sensor fails or malfunctions, it can lead to issues with brake performance, potentially affecting the vehicle's ability to stop efficiently and safely.
Common Causes of C0047
- Faulty brake booster pressure sensor
- Wiring or electrical issues
- Vacuum leak in the brake booster system
- Brake fluid leakage
- Issues with the brake booster itself
Symptoms of C0047
- Illuminated brake warning light on the dashboard
- Soft or spongy brake pedal feel
- Increased stopping distance
- ABS system may be disabled
- Loss of power brakes
How to Fix C0047
- Diagnose the exact cause of the C0047 code using a scan tool
- Inspect the brake booster pressure sensor and wiring for any damage or corrosion
- Check for any vacuum leaks in the brake booster system
- Replace the faulty brake booster pressure sensor
- Clear the code and test drive the vehicle to ensure the issue has been resolved
Cost to Fix C0047
The typical repair costs for addressing a C0047 code related to the brake booster pressure sensor can range from $200 to $500, including parts and labor. However, as mentioned earlier, the specific costs can vary based on factors such as location, vehicle make and model, and labor rates at auto repair shops.
